Daily Budget Breakdown
Budget
Hostels, street food, free attractions
INR 1500
per day
Weekly: INR 10500
Monthly: INR 45000
Examples
- π¨Hotel Continental dorm bedINR 700
- π½οΈStreet food at Bistupur Market (samosas, chaat)INR 300
- πLocal auto-rickshaw ridesINR 300
- ποΈVisit Jubilee Park and admire the TISCO Founder's StatueINR 200
Mid-Range
3-star hotels, restaurants, guided tours
INR 3500
per day
Weekly: INR 24500
Monthly: INR 105000
Examples
- π¨The Boulevard Hotel standard roomINR 1800
- π½οΈLunch at Swosti Grand's buffetINR 700
- πApp-based taxi (Ola/Uber) for local travelINR 600
- ποΈExplore Tata Steel Zoological ParkINR 400
Luxury
5-star hotels, fine dining, private tours
INR 8000
per day
Weekly: INR 56000
Monthly: INR 240000
Examples
- π¨Ramada by Wyndham Jamshedpur roomINR 4500
- π½οΈDinner at Yellow Tree Cafe with diverse cuisineINR 2000
- πPrivate car hire for the dayINR 1000
- ποΈVisit Dimna Lake and enjoy boatingINR 500

Cost by Neighbourhood
| Neighbourhood | Budget Level | vs City Centre |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bistupur | Mid-range | similar | first-timers, families |
| Sakchi | Budget | cheaper | foodies, budget |
| Kadma | Budget | similar | families, couples |
| Telco Colony | Mid-range | similar | families, digital nomads |
